    bedco (12/13)

    For part a) of this question, should the variances for bed sheets and pillow cases be calculated separately and then be added to arrive at the total variance, or should they be calculated in combined form.

    Also how to calculate the total material cost variance. Should actual usage and price be used or should revised usage and price be used.

    The question specifically asks for them to be calculated separately, and in total. As regards the total, you do not need to calculate this separately – just add together the individual variances.

    For the cost variances, there are arguments for using either the actual quantity or the revised quantity and the examiner accepts either (even though the answers are different). The examiner states this in her answer (and I explain this in my free lectures).

    The easiest way and the way that the current examiner prefers is the way that I explain in my free lectures. i.e using the actual quantity and comparing the original standard price with the revised price for the planning variance, and comparing the actual price with the revised price for the operational variance.
